Страница 1 из 2 12 ПоследняяПоследняя
Показано с 1 по 10 из 15

Тема: Как правильно подключить и настроить монитор с тачскрином

  1. #1
    Новичок
    Регистрация
    28.10.2015
    Адрес
    Москва
    Сообщений
    7
    Поблагодарил(а)
    0
    Благодарностей: 0 (сообщений: 0)

    Question Как правильно подключить и настроить монитор с тачскрином

    Всем привет!

    Необходимо собрать из двух полумертвых рабочих станций официанта одну рабочую. Ситуация в том, что один терминал был с программируемой клавиатурой и с обычным монитором, а второй был залит водой, но с работающим сенсорным дисплеем. Ранее никогда не пользовался мониторами с тачскрином, поэтому плз не пинайте, а помогите.

    Рабочие станции представляют из себя корпуса с мат.платами Mini-ITX. В том что залит использовалась мать ELITEGROUP PMI8M (V2.0), название второй мат.платы на текстолите не нашел, но очень она похожа на первую. Дисплей OL-1501 (RS232).
    Быстренько пересобрал все в один корпус, включил, заработало, загружается RK6, взмах картой, вошли. Но экран не реагирует на нажатия.
    Дальше начались танцы с бубном - пробовал разные СОМ-порты, разные заведомо рабочие мониторы во всех возможных вариантах подключения ... Не работает.
    Обратил внимание что у всех корпусов наружу торчат шлейфы с СОМ-портами, подключенными на мат.платах в СОМ4, хотя рядом есть свободные порты. Зачем?
    Догадался залезть в autoexec.bat и rkeeper6.ini. Оказалось что на разных станциях прописаны настройки для разных СОМ-портов.
    Перепробовал еще несколько вариантов с настройками и окончательно запутался что, где и как было прописано. Собрал все это железо с собой и поехал не спеша думать.

    В итоге: сейчас я могу загрузиться в NC, в RK6 не могу т.к. комп находится в другой сети где нет сервера. Круглый разъем белого провода от монитора подключен в гнездо для мышки, СОМ-разъем в СОМ1 (нижний) на мат.плате. Шнур от считывателя карт соответственно в гнездо для клавиатуры.

    autoexec.bat:
    Код:
    prompt $p$g
    path=c:\util;c:\dos;c:\net
    mode com1:96,n,8,1,r
    mode com2:96,n,8,1,r
    mode com3:96,n,8,1,r
    mode com4:96,n,8,1,r
    vga#font
    dtime
    cd \net
    share
    net start
    :pause
    cd\
    cd \rkclient.49
    rkeeper6
    c:\nc\nc
    rkeeper6.ini
    Код:
    Network=ON
    ServerName=RLSERV
    CustomerDisplay=OFF
    APServer=AServ
    RemoteChecksSeparate=ON
    comport2baud=9600
    comport4baud=9600
    comport3baud=9600
    color=ON
    256Color=ON
    HiResolution=ON
    Подскажите, плз, что и где мне надо прописать/исправить чтобы заработал сенсор ? Как проверить сенсор без запуска RK6?

  2. #2
    Разбирающийся Аватар для PLC
    Регистрация
    05.12.2006
    Сообщений
    161
    Поблагодарил(а)
    0
    Благодарностей: 3 (сообщений: 1)
    1 нужен драйвер OL-1501 (TOUCHKIT)
    2 в autoexec.bat после сети добавить tpanel -g800x600
    3 найти на форуме о настройке тача в кипере

  3. #3
    Разбирающийся Аватар для okis
    Регистрация
    21.10.2007
    Адрес
    Москва
    Сообщений
    1,447
    Поблагодарил(а)
    2
    Благодарностей: 31 (сообщений: 21)
    Жесткий диск со станции, которая работала с сенсорным экраном живой?
    Попробуйте загрузиться с него.

  4. #4
    Новичок
    Регистрация
    28.10.2015
    Адрес
    Москва
    Сообщений
    7
    Поблагодарил(а)
    0
    Благодарностей: 0 (сообщений: 0)
    Да, действительно на залитом компе была такая строчка в autoexec.bat. Прописал, теперь при подключении в любой СОМ-порт вот так:

    c:\tkit\tpanel -g800x600
    TouchKit for DOS Version 6.00.07.4315

    Test TKT1...no panel found
    Test TKT2...no panel found
    Test PS2...no panel found

    Что такое TKT1, TKT2 ?? Почему может не находить ?

    ---------- Добавлено в 17:05 ---------- Предыдущее сообщение было размещено в 17:02 ----------

    Жесткий диск со станции, которая работала с сенсорным экраном живой?
    Попробуйте загрузиться с него.
    Есть образ. Там вместо диска был установлен Transcend 1Gb 40pin, на второй матери только SATA.. В крайнем случае если ничего не поможет разверну образ на флешку и попробую с нее загрузиться...

    ---------- Добавлено в 17:41 ---------- Предыдущее сообщение было размещено в 17:05 ----------

    В итоге загрузиться в сборку с компа к которому был подключен изначально тач оказалось лучшим решением. Сразу бросилось в глаза что там Windows 98 а не MS-DOS. В одном единственном из портов тач определился как TKT2. Это нормально что в остальных портах не работает ?
    Пролез по утилитам в папке TKIT: tkdraw.exe нормально работает, калибровка на 4 и 25 точек упорно не чувствуют когда на кресты нажимаю. Это нормально ?

    Дотошно спрашиваю, т.к. возможности проверить работу в RK6 сейчас нет, не хотелось бы приехать обратно на место со всем железом и опять начать танцы с бубном.

  5. #5
    Разбирающийся
    Регистрация
    18.10.2012
    Адрес
    Новосибирск, Омск
    Сообщений
    5,362
    Поблагодарил(а)
    188
    Благодарностей: 461 (сообщений: 364)
    калибровка на 4 и 25 точек упорно не чувствуют когда на кресты нажимаю.
    Нажать и подержать пару секунд.
    Ильин Александр, Компания "Соттос"
    г Новосибирск +7 (383) 373-96-98; +7 (909) 533-93-92; nsk@sottos.ru
    г Омск +7 (3812) 377-902; +7 (905) 098-92-06; abc@sottos.ru
    www.sottos.ru | vk.com/sottos | fb.com/sottosru
    Продажа и установка ПО R-Keeper, обучение, техническая поддержка 24/7

  6. #6
    Новичок
    Регистрация
    28.10.2015
    Адрес
    Москва
    Сообщений
    7
    Поблагодарил(а)
    0
    Благодарностей: 0 (сообщений: 0)
    Нажать и подержать пару секунд.
    Да, действительно, это помогло )) Спасибо всем большое, вроде мелочи, но без вас бы не разобрался. Завтра попробую поставить на место

  7. #7
    Новичок
    Регистрация
    28.10.2015
    Адрес
    Москва
    Сообщений
    7
    Поблагодарил(а)
    0
    Благодарностей: 0 (сообщений: 0)
    Беда не приходит одна (( Привожу на место, включаю, сенсор не работает. Начинаю разбираться - где то на конце кабеля или в пайке порта на мать плохой контакт - работает при легком нажатии, фиксировать нереально, очень плавающий эффект.
    Подскажите, как правильно изменить настройки чтобы проверить тач при подключении к СОМ1??

    Сейчас он определяется только как TKT2, при подключении в любой из трех оставшихся СОМ получаем ...no panel found.
    Текущий autoexec.bat приведен выше.
    На кассовом сервере видел в autoexec записи:
    Код:
    set tkt1=2f8 3
    c:\tkit\tpanel tkt1 -g 800x600
    Мне как то так же надо прописать ?

  8. #8
    Сведущий
    Регистрация
    14.01.2014
    Адрес
    Орел, РФ
    Сообщений
    72
    Поблагодарил(а)
    0
    Благодарностей: 0 (сообщений: 0)
    Test TKT1...no panel found
    Test TKT2...no panel found
    Test PS2...no panel found
    А вот это не настораживает? Драйвер в упор не замечает ваш тач. Поэтому сенсор и не работает. Ещё вариант: Если терминал OL — вполне возможно, что сенсор не пашет, т.к. не подключен ps/2 хвостик в комп.
    Надо добиться TKT1 = что-то там ok при старте терминала. Можно попробовать повыполнять вот такие команды:
    set tkt1 = $2e8 4, где значение — адрес com-порта и его прерывание, можно кронтестом посмотреть, если интегрированный или nmdosin-ом/gemdosin-ом, если на плате расширения.
    далее выполнить:
    tpanel -m -1, где -m отключает курсор мыши, -1 ищет только tkt1, и только там где прописали.

    Пишу по памяти, так что не обессудьте. Все команды можно посмотреть выполнив tpanel /? в коммандной строке.

    Ранее никогда не пользовался мониторами с тачскрином, поэтому плз не пинайте, а помогите.
    Следует понимать как: «Ранее никогда не работал с досом на уровне коммандной строки, поэтому напишите что надо там в неё тайпнуть, чтобы всё завелось.» Честнее надо быть.

  9. #9
    Новичок
    Регистрация
    28.10.2015
    Адрес
    Москва
    Сообщений
    7
    Поблагодарил(а)
    0
    Благодарностей: 0 (сообщений: 0)
    Невнимательно читали. Тач все таки заработал, но только как ТКТ2, мышиный хвост был подключен. Сейчас я хочу понять проблема в кабеле или в пайке порта.

    Значит мое предположение было правильно?

    Код:
    set tkt1=2f8 3
    c:\tkit\tpanel tkt1 -g 800x600
    адрес com-порта и его прерывание, можно кронтестом посмотреть
    вот тут модно поподробнее - как посмотреть адреса и IRQ всех СОМ портов?

    P.s. Я вполне честен. Я из того поколения когда "серьезной" угрозой был edd-1800, aidstest Лозинского и FIDO rulez. А вот с тачами действительно не работал.

  10. #10
    Сведущий
    Регистрация
    14.01.2014
    Адрес
    Орел, РФ
    Сообщений
    72
    Поблагодарил(а)
    0
    Благодарностей: 0 (сообщений: 0)
    вот тут модно поподробнее - как посмотреть адреса и IRQ всех СОМ портов?
    В корне должен лежать каталог UTIL. Если нет — смотреть в дистрибутив с кассовой частью РК. Там есть утилитка krontest.exe. Запускаем, сразу жмём Esc или Pause(память она съедает будь здоров) и смотрим на табличку.

    Да, всё верно, только прописать надо как set tkt2=%addr IRQ% и в tpanel tkt2 -g 800x600. Результатом станет tkt2 %бла-бла-бла% ok и корректный старт станции.
    Про tkt. tkt1 - com1, tkt2 - com2. И всё отличие. В данном случае речь идёт про тач, заинсталенный на com2.

Похожие темы

  1. Помогите настроить монитор
    от Lecs2015 в разделе R-Keeper 7
    Ответов: 1
    Последнее сообщение: 25.09.2015, 18:04
  2. Тачскрин Fujitsu как правильно подключить?
    от Zlaya_Boroda в разделе RK: Тачскрины
    Ответов: 1
    Последнее сообщение: 29.04.2014, 11:32
  3. Ответов: 7
    Последнее сообщение: 05.12.2010, 23:28
  4. Ответов: 0
    Последнее сообщение: 02.10.2008, 10:58
  5. Как подключить и настроить весы.
    от Admin в разделе R-Keeper 6
    Ответов: 3
    Последнее сообщение: 01.03.2007, 17:53

Метки этой темы

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•